COPY 명령어의 synopsis 가 다음과 같습니다.
COPY [ BINARY ] table [ WITH OIDS ]
FROM { 'filename' | stdin }
[ [USING] DELIMITERS 'delimiter' ]
[ WITH NULL AS 'null string' ]
COPY [ BINARY ] table [ WITH OIDS ]
TO { 'filename' | stdout }
[ [USING] DELIMITERS 'delimiter' ]
[ WITH NULL AS 'null string' ]
현재까지는 line delimeter 는 지원하지 않고 있습니다. MySQL 은 되는 것으로 알고 있습니다.
-- 김남수 님이 쓰신 글:
>> 안녕하세요.
>>
>> pgsql 에서는 file 과 db 간에 데이터 교환을 위해 copy 라는 명령을 쓰더군요. 필드간의 구분은 다양하게 사용자가 결정해서 사용할 수가 있던데,
>> 레코드의 끝은 어떻게 표현하나요?
>>
>> 디폴트로 엔터 를 인식하는거 같던데, 다른 기호를 쓸수가 있는지 궁금합니다.
>>
>> 정보 부탁드립니다.
>> 좋은 하루 되세요.
|